Flexibilty not required

To complain about the inflexibilty of England's batting order after their pummelling earlier today by South Africa misses the point entirely. This is a twenty over thrash we're talking about. If Alistair Cook and Joe Denly are not judged capable of scoring at over twelve an over, then they shouldn't be in the team to begin with. Sixes, not flexibility, matter most in Twenty20 cricket.
